Tension indicator

For narrow webs

The NWI Narrow Web Indicator, a cantilevered idler roller, tension transducer and digital LED tension display, is combined in one unit. The NWI is for monitoring process tension on narrow-web printing presses and converting machinery. The base of the NWI roll bolts onto the cantilevered frame of a press at a desired point in the web path and reads actual tension on the LED meter at the roll end.

Auto-sleeve changeover

For CI-flexo presses

Introduced at the recent Converflex Europe fair, the new Axioma 8 Millennium CNC sleeve-changeover system is fully automatic, computerized and allows the operator to fully disengage it from the CI-flexo press to continuously run the machine in manual mode, if necessary. More than 1,000 job setups can be memorized, including the functions of unwinding/winding tension, tunnel and color temperature settings, longitudinal and transverse register positions and printing pressure. Register can be regulated when the press is not running, thus avoiding production waste. In demonstrations, the machine started new jobs with only 33 ft of film waste.

Feedblock

Coming to K 2001

The Rotatable Tuning Feedblock has rotatable tuning pins that are adjustable on-the-fly. With the pins strategically located at the flow stream convergence point of each flow channel, multiple tuning profiles can be achieved on each channel. Rotating a different face of the pin into the exit channel varies the geometry of the exiting material simply and quickly.

Motors

Meet or exceed CEE efficiencies

The co.'s full-range of three-phase WATTSAVER® motors, from 1 to 125 HP, now meet or exceed CEE efficiency levels. The motors also feature the IRIS™ insulation system that provides extra protection against voltage spikes induced by variable frequency drives. The system includes specially formed phase insulation, cushioned and sleeved connections, deep-penetrating varnish and special spike-resistant magnet wire.

Baler

Makes densely-packed bales

The new Ram II baler produces densely-packed bales weighing up to 2,000 lbs. and measuring up to 50 cu. ft. Capable of 47,000 cu. ft. of displacement per hr., the machine produces up to 25 bales/hr. of various grade scrap paper including OCC, ONP, colored book, SBS, sorted office waste, file folder stock, mixed paper and more. Heavier, denser bales allow operators to reduce wire use, move fewer bales and fit more bales per shipment.

Viscometer

For paints, inks, coating & adhesives

The VTA-120 Viscosel is new and improved with a solvent valve monitor gauge added to the face panel. The gauge visually indicates when the Viscosel detects viscosity above the preset value and triggers the valve to open and add solvent. A secondary scale has been added to the main viscosity gauge to allow operators to mark the corresponding Zahn cup sec. with the percent torque measurement scale. A spring-loaded sample-chamber release mechanism has been added to make the change of the measurement cylinder fast and simple. Pneumatically operated, the system is intrinsically safe for use in hazardous areas. It is constructed for trouble-free operation in demanding industrial environments.

Magnetic cylinders & bases

Cuts cost

Permanent cylinders and bases eliminate the need for conventional mounting materials and much of the labor that goes with them. The powerful permanent magnets embedded in the co.'s cylinders and flat bases grip steel-backed plates and dies, holding them firmly in place so that they stay in register even during high-speed press runs. Conventional plates can be mounted on steel carriers or held in place by an optional Fast-Lock cylinder lock-up system. Changeovers are fast and significantly reduce normal makeready times for both bases and cylinders. The flat bases and cylinders are built to OEM press specifications. Construction is either stainless steel or a patented design made from economical carbon steel.
